
Mairead McGuinness - the
European Commissioner for financial services, financial stability and capital markets union - delivered a speech today titled "Corporate reporting in the Capital Markets Union after Wirecard": see
here. The Commissioner used her speech to explain that a public consultation on corporate reporting would take place later this year
and, in respect of what she termed the three "core pillars to high-quality reporting", she identified various issues that are likely to be considered.
